Stop Losing Customers to the “Invisible” Search Problem

Many businesses pour money into ads or maintain a website that looks good but fails to attract nearby customers. The problem is usually not “no marketing,” but weak local relevance—your site doesn’t clearly signal local seo services where you operate and who you serve. When search engines can’t connect your business to a specific area, your rankings stall even if your service quality is strong.

Another common issue is inconsistent business information across the web. If your name, address, phone number, and service descriptions vary between directories, maps, and your website, trust drops and local results become harder to win. Customers may also encounter outdated details, leading to missed calls, wrong directions, and abandoned enquiries.

To diagnose the gap, start with a simple review of how your business appears in map listings and local search results. Check whether you show up for the types of searches your customers use, and whether your listing includes accurate categories, a strong description, and photos that reflect real service. Then audit your website for location signals such as service areas, clear contact details, and dedicated pages that match the way people search locally.

Once you identify where the inconsistency is coming from, you can fix it systematically rather than guessing. That approach helps you move from “we have a website” to “we earn visibility in the places customers look first.” For businesses that rely on high-intent leads, improving these signals can be the difference between being overlooked and consistently generating calls.

Build a Local Ranking Plan That Solves the Real Bottlenecks

Local search success depends on multiple factors working together, not a single trick. You need strong on-page optimisation, a dependable site structure, and a content strategy that answers the questions people seo for dentists ask before they book. If your pages are generic, they won’t match local intent, and search engines won’t have enough context to rank you for nearby searches.

For service businesses, the biggest bottleneck is often thin or poorly targeted content. A “Services” page alone may not be enough to compete in the local results, especially against competitors with location-specific pages and proof of real-world expertise. When your site explains what you do, where you do it, and why customers should choose you, the likelihood of qualified traffic increases.

Practical local optimisation should also include a plan for reviews and reputation signals. Reviews influence click-through rates and help search engines evaluate credibility, particularly when they are specific, consistent, and tied to real customer experiences. Ask for reviews in a way that feels natural—after a successful outcome—then respond professionally to every review to show active engagement.

Finally, ensure technical foundations support local performance. Fast loading pages, clean internal linking, mobile-friendly layouts, and schema markup all help search engines interpret your business details. When the technical layer and the content layer work together, your visibility becomes more stable and your rankings are less likely to fluctuate.

Use Industry-Focused Strategies for Dentists and Similar Clinics

Health and service professionals face extra challenges because patients compare options carefully. For clinics, the content must build trust, explain the process clearly, and address concerns in plain language. If your website lacks clear service pathways, strong local proof, and easy ways to contact you, potential patients will move on quickly.

One of the most effective solutions is creating pages that reflect real dental services with local relevance. Instead of only listing treatments, describe what happens during consultations, how appointments are scheduled, and what makes the practice a good fit for patients in the area. This helps match the intent behind searches and reduces the friction that leads to abandoned enquiry forms.

It also helps to align your marketing with the way people search when they need care urgently or for specific goals. Many patients search for solutions like emergency appointments, checkups, or specific procedures, alongside location. When your site uses clear headings, relevant FAQs, and supporting evidence, it becomes easier for both users and search engines to understand what you offer.

In addition, optimise your maps visibility with a complete, accurate profile and a steady stream of fresh photos and updates. Ensure appointment options are visible, your service categories are correct, and your contact details are consistent everywhere. When combined with patient-focused content and a reputation plan, your clinic can compete more effectively for high-intent searches.
